好有缘导航网

小程序性能优化宝典:20个案例帮你提升用户体验 (小程序性能优化面试题)


文章编号:46201 / 分类:行业资讯 / 更新时间:2024-12-15 14:11:11 / 浏览:

前言

小程序性能优化宝典20个案例帮你提升用户体 小程序作为一种新的应用形态,因其便捷、低门槛等优势受到广泛欢迎。在小程序开发过程中,性能优化也成为开发者们不得不面对的一大难题。本文将深入浅出地讲解小程序性能优化的原理和方法,并提供20个真实案例,帮助开发者们提升小程序用户体验。

小程序性能优化原理

小程序性能优化的核心在于减少资源消耗和缩短响应时间。以下是一些基本原则:减少代码包体积:代码包体积过大将导致小程序加载缓慢。减少请求次数:不必要的网络请求会浪费时间和资源。优化算法和数据结构:高效的算法和数据结构可以提高执行速度。合理使用第三方库:第三方库虽然方便,但也会增加小程序体积。

20个小程序性能优化案例

下面我们将介绍20个真实的小程序性能优化案例,涵盖代码、网络、算法、第三方库等方面。

代码优化

案例1:使用箭头函数代替匿名函数// 原代码 function add(a, b) {return a + b; }// 优化后 const add = (a, b) => a + b;案例2:避免使用全局变量全局变量会占用大量内存,影响小程序性能。案例3:使用模板字符串代替拼接字符串// 原代码 const str = "你好," + name + "同学!";// 优化后 const str = `你好,${name}同学!`;

网络优化

案例4:使用缓存机制缓存机制可以减少不必要的网络请求。案例5:合理设置请求超时时间超时时间过长会浪费时间,过短又可能导致请求失败。案例6:使用响应拦截器响应拦截器可以对响应数据进行处理,减少数据开销。

算法优化

案例7:使用二分查找算法二分查找算法可以快速查找元素,提高效率。案例8:使用归并排序算法归并排序算法是一种稳定、高效的排序算法。案例9:使用空间换时间优化算法在牺牲一定内存的情况下,可以提高算法执行速度。

第三方库优化

案例10:合理使用第三方库第三方库虽然方便,但使用过多会增加小程序体积。案例11:选择轻量级第三方库优先选择体积小、功能精简的第三方库。案例12:按需加载第三方库只在需要时加载第三方库,避免浪费资源。

其他优化技巧

案例13:优化图片资源对图片进行压缩,减少体积。案例14:使用懒加载只加载当前页面的数据,减少初始加载时间。案例15:使用原子化操作将大操作拆分成小操作,提高并发性。案例16:避免使用循环嵌套循环嵌套会降低代码执行效率。案例17:使用 wx.nextTick()将耗时操作推迟到下一帧执行,提高响应速度。案例18:使用性能监控工具使用性能监控工具可以实时监测小程序性能,发现问题。案例19:遵循小程序官方文档小程序官方文档提供了详细的性能优化指南,开发者应仔细阅读。案例20:进行性能测试通过性能测试,可以发现小程序性能瓶颈并进行改进。

小程序性能优化面试题

以下是一些常见的小程序性能优化面试题:如何优化小程序代码体积?如何减少小程序网络请求次数?如何优化小程序算法?如何合理使用小程序第三方库?如何使用性能监控工具监测小程序性能?

总结

小程序性能优化是一项持续的过程,需要开发者不断学习和实践。本文介绍的20个案例涵盖了小程序性能优化各个方面,希望能够帮助开发者们提升小程序用户体验。通过遵循这些优化原则和掌握这些真实案例,开发者们可以显著提高小程序性能,为用户提供流畅、高效的使用体验。
相关标签: 20个案例帮你提升用户体验小程序性能优化宝典小程序性能优化面试题

本文地址:http://www.hyyidc.com/article/46201.html

上一篇:小程序性能优化秘诀大公开案例分享与优化策...
下一篇:小程序性能优化实战宝典案例解读与优化方法...

温馨提示

做上本站友情链接,在您站上点击一次,即可自动收录并自动排在本站第一位!
<a href="http://www.hyyidc.com/" target="_blank">好有缘导航网</a>